hi-I have a 12 by 60 older mobile home-original roof was flat with a slight pitch over the kitchen-it is tin/metal-had some leaks so had someone put a compound that looked like tar over the seams and over damaged areas-worked some but still had some leaks-then had rolled roofing put on-this worked until someone shoveled off the roof and took a small area of the rolled roofing off which in turn had leaks again-decided to stop patching and have new roof installed-a frame was built around entire roof so it would be even across-5-12 pitch-then the trusses were put on and metal panels attached-ridge cap and soft-it installed with the foam strips supplied for installation-on the inside of trailer the ceiling the old ceiling was removed along with old insulation -replaced the supports across that had been water damaged-you could see the inside of the original tin/metal exposed-then new insulation(pink stuff) installed and tongue and groove cedar installed-looked so good until drip drip drip started-in multiple places in ceiling-cut out area on end of trailer to crawl into to space between old roof and new to see if new metal roof was leaking-not the case-dry everywhere and after alot of rain-seems to leak more when it gets warmer outside with lots of sun-took some of the tongue and groove cedar off inside and the tin/metal had a layer of frost-like on it-as the heat from inside got to it it melted and dripped-someone suggested taking all of the cedar off-replace any water damaged insulation-put plastic on then put cedar back on to create a vapor barrier-seems to me that water may now just drip onto plastic and be contained but still have insulation getting wet-by the way there are vents at the ends of the trailer going into pitched space-need some advice before we tear out all the cedar and start over-thanks in advance
